Amazon EC2 opens beta to all software developers & biz

Amazon Web Services LLC announced new flexibility for Amazon Elastic Compute Cloud (Amazon EC2) by introducing multiple instance types for Amazon EC2 developers. Customers can now choose compute instances up to eight times as powerful as those previously available, addressing a popular user request. Additionally, Amazon Web Services announced that the Amazon EC2 beta, which previously limited the number of new registrants, is now open to all developers.

"We continue to be pleased by the tremendous level of interest from the developer and business communities in Amazon EC2," said Adam Selipsky, Vice President of Product Management and Developer Relations, Amazon Web Services. "Our beta participants provided important feedback that we used to improve the service and add new features like the multiple instance types that we introduced today. We're excited to open up the service to all developers and see the next wave of innovative businesses and applications built on Amazon EC2."

Just as Amazon Simple Storage Service (Amazon S3) enables storage in the cloud, Amazon EC2 enables resizable "compute" capacity in the cloud to make web-scale computing easier for developers. Customers use a simple web service interface to obtain and configure capacity on Amazon's proven computing environment. New server instances can be obtained and booted automatically as a developer's computing requirements change.

This "elastic" nature of Amazon EC2 allows any developer to reach the scale of major internet players like Amazon.com, but without the significant cost of building out and maintaining a massive back-end infrastructure. Amazon EC2 changes the economics of computing by allowing developers to pay only for the capacity they actually use.
